A filling breakfast bowl made by blending frozen banana with milk and oats, then topping with fresh fruit and nuts. Eaten with a spoon, its thick consistency sets it apart from a classic smoothie, offering a heartier morning meal.

Step by Step

How to make it?

1

Freeze the bananas

120 min

Slice the bananas and arrange in a single layer on a tray, then freeze for at least 2 hours.

2

Blend

5 min

Blend the frozen banana slices with milk, oats, and honey until thick and smooth.

3

Transfer to a bowl

2 min

Transfer the mixture to a bowl and smooth the surface.

4

Garnish and serve

3 min

Sprinkle sliced strawberries and chopped walnuts on top and serve immediately.

Reminder

Important: Slice the bananas and freeze them at least 2 hours in advance; the bowl only gets a thick, spoonable consistency with frozen banana. Allergen: oats may contain gluten (cross-contamination), contains milk.
